I believe that Hillary is the MOST PROBABLE Democrat nominee in 2020, based on the Democrat Primary & Convention rules.

Primary Rules have been changed in many states to give proportional number of delegates, rather than winner-take-all. This will make it near-impossible for any candidate in this large field to get the 50% delegates for a first-ballot nomination.

Convention Rules for “Superdelegates” have changed. (Hillary had nearly all Superdelegates in 2016 in her pocket; Superdelegates were about 1/3 of all votes at convention - Bernie had no chance.) They don’t vote on first ballot (see above - it will be an inconclusive round), but they vote on subsequent ones; additionally, delegates can change their voting on 2nd or later ballot (see each state on this). Most likely some of the “also-ran” candidates would direct their delegates to vote for “the best consensus candidate”... who would be Hillary.

I predict Hillary will be “drafted” to be candidate on 2nd or 3rd ballot. She will be well rested and healthy because she didn’t have to go thru the primary grind!
